Role Title: Actuary / Senior Actuary - LMRe Specialty

Department: Actuarial

Team: LM Re Actuarial

Location: London

About the Role:

The Specialty Metaline remit includes Aviation, Cyber, Credit, Surety, Mortgage, Treaty Personal Accident, and Crisis Management throughout LMRe on a global basis. This role will provide actuarial pricing support and portfolio analytics to improve business performance, growth, and meet strategic goals within the Specialty meta-line Actuarial team. Core responsibilities include case pricing, pricing transformation support, portfolio analytics for strategic decision-making, and planning initiatives.

You will work closely with:

  • Underwriting: To enhance underwriting decision-making through account pricing, portfolio analysis, and product development.
  • Reserving: To understand reserve drivers, communicate findings, and improve pricing/reserving outputs based on feedback.
  • Finance: To coordinate with finance partners and understand business results.

About the Department & Team:

The LMRe Actuarial team evaluates business performance and provides risk-based insights for strategy and risk mitigation. The team covers pricing, business planning, data & analytics, capital management, exposure management, and reinsurance strategy. The team comprises about 20 actuaries globally, supporting underwriters across Latin America, Miami, Bermuda, London, Paris, Madrid, Milan, Amsterdam, and Cologne. The role reports to the Pricing Head of Reinsurance Specialty.
